After spending several years in the embryonic form of Dream
6 (under which name they released an EP for Happy Hermit in
France), Hollywood, California, USA rock band Concrete
Blonde formed in 1986.

The founders of the group, former Sparks’s personnel Earle
(production) and Jim Mankey (guitars) plus Johnette
Napolitano (bass, vocals), were joined by Harry Rushakoff
(drums) for their debut on I.R.S. Records. Its alluring mix
of energy, sensitivity and streetwise wit secured Concrete
Blonde a positive response from both the music press and
more mature rock audiences.

For Free Napolitano handed over bass duties to new member
Alan Bloch, allowing her to concentrate on singing.
Irrespective of this, she remained the focus of the band -
